摘要
Comprehensively deepening reform is a general objective for improving and developing the socialist system with Chinese characteristics. As an important part of Chinese governance system, universities are necessarily expected to be improved in the process of deepening reform. Under the mainstream of university governance, its main part-college governance will be the priority among priorities for deepening university governance. College education governance is a basic and dynamic process. It can be affected by financial policy, organization structure, technology and cultural environment. Among those, technological environment is an important repulsion for the modernization and humanization for education governance. As a tendency technology, big data will promote Chinese senior education institutions into a new time. From the three aspects including education governance philosophy, education governance mode and college education management, this article analyzes the impact of big data brought to the college education governance for Chinese universities; meanwhile, it further expounds the difficulty in data governance, data shortage and inadequacy of data motives education governance may be faced with in the time of big data.
